
Devolo dLAN 200 AVeasy powerline adapter review
In this article I wanted to take a look at Ethernet over your power line. This technology has been here for years and is as simple as it can be you utilize the power sockets in your house to transport a data signal carrying a network signal. All you need are two or more homeplug adapters also known as Powerline Ethernet adapters. Devolo is the one company that caught my attention. They offer 200 Mbit/sec adapters. You plug them in connect one to your PC and another one to say your internet router and you are good to go.
